chilD sEaTs: attachment using the isofix system
x = Seat not suitable for fitting child seats of this type.
iUf/il = On equipped vehicles, seat which allows an approved "Universal"/"semi-universal" or "vehicle specific" child seat to be
attached using the ISOFIX system; check that it can be fitted.
(1) If necessary, position the vehicle seat as far back as possible. In order to install a rear-facing child seat, move the front seat
as far forward as possible, then move the front seat back as far as it will go, without allowing it to come into contact with the
child seat.
(2) In all situations, remove the rear headrest of the seat on which the child seat is positioned. This must be done before fitting the
child seat. ➥ 1.19. Move the seat in front of the child forwards, move the seatback forward to avoid contact between the seat
and the child's legs.
The size of the ISOFIX child seat is indicated by a letter:
– A, B and B1: for forward-facing seats in group 1 (9 to 18 kg);
– C and D: shell seat or rear-facing seats in group 0+ (less than 13 kg) or group 1 (9 to 18 kg);
– E: rear-facing shell seats in group 0 (less than 10 kg) or 0+ (less than 13 kg);
– F and G: cots in group 0 (less than 10 kg).
